[0001] This invention relates to the field of power system simulation technology, and in particular to a multimodal simulation method and system based on real-time data components. Background Technology

[0002] Simulation technology is playing an increasingly important role in power system equipment testing, system optimization, and training simulation. For example, patent application CN109190305B discloses a panoramic real-time simulation method for power systems, including: constructing primary and secondary system models of a substation respectively; writing the simulation data for each step of the primary system model into a real-time database; after the primary system model has calculated the simulation data for any step and written it into the real-time database, the secondary system model collects the data from the real-time database; simultaneously, the primary system model transmits the simulation data to a signal conversion device; if the primary system model receives the action information sent by the secondary system model and simultaneously receives the information returned by the signal conversion device to the primary system model, then simulation is performed based on the current topology. This patent coordinates and synchronizes the operation of primary system simulation, secondary equipment simulation, and some real secondary equipment, achieving interoperability and thus forming a complete simulation testing system that ensures seamless integration between the simulation platform and real secondary equipment and virtual digital protection.

[0003] However, although the aforementioned patents have achieved co-simulation of the primary and secondary systems, the following problems still exist:

[0004] Existing technologies lack flexible multimodal interaction design capabilities, making it difficult to quickly customize visual interfaces and interaction logic according to different business needs. They cannot meet the diverse simulation scenario requirements. In terms of simulation operation and deployment, they lack cross-platform adaptive optimization mechanisms, cannot dynamically adjust resource allocation according to system load, and are difficult to achieve lightweight deployment and continuous optimization. The simulation efficiency and reliability in complex power grid business scenarios urgently need to be improved. Summary of the Invention

[0067] Specifically, redundancy is assessed in the collected real-time data, and a real-time data acquisition anomaly alarm is triggered when redundancy is abnormal, including:

[0068] Retrieve real-time data collected from the data source;

[0069] Determine the standard deviation of the data volume collected in all windows based on the amount of data collected in each sliding window of the data source.

[0070] Retrieve the number of data collections for each sliding window;

[0071] The data deviation index is determined by using the standard deviation of the data volume corresponding to all window data collections corresponding to the data source and the number of data collections corresponding to each sliding window.

[0072] The data deviation index is compared with a preset data deviation index threshold, wherein the data deviation index threshold is determined based on experience;

[0073] When the data deviation index exceeds the preset data deviation index threshold, redundancy is determined, and a real-time data acquisition anomaly alarm is triggered when redundancy is abnormal.

[0074] The technical effects of the above solution are as follows: Based on a sliding window mechanism, real-time data streams are dynamically analyzed in time segments, enabling the immediate capture of abnormal fluctuations during data acquisition and avoiding cumulative errors caused by delayed detection. Combining the standard deviation with the deviation index of the number of acquisitions, it can quickly identify situations where data volume fluctuations exceed the normal range, ensuring that abnormal states are detected immediately. By measuring the dispersion of data volume within the sliding window using the standard deviation, redundant features such as "abnormally concentrated or sparse data volume" (e.g., duplicate acquisition, missed acquisition) can be effectively identified. Introducing the number of acquisitions as a correction factor allows the deviation index to simultaneously reflect "data volume fluctuations" and "acquisition frequency stability," avoiding misjudgments based on a single dimension and improving the accuracy of redundancy detection. The entire process, from data retrieval and index calculation to threshold comparison, is automated, reducing manual intervention costs and the risk of human error, making it suitable for high-concurrency, high-frequency data acquisition scenarios. When the deviation index exceeds the threshold, a real-time alarm is triggered, which can be linked with the data acquisition system to achieve closed-loop control of "monitoring-judgment-response," ensuring the reliability of the data acquisition chain. Early identification of redundant data anomalies can prevent invalid data from occupying storage resources and consuming computing power, improving data quality from the source.

[0075] Specifically, when the data deviation index exceeds a preset data deviation index threshold, a redundancy determination is performed, including:

[0076] When the data deviation index exceeds a preset data deviation index threshold, the data deviation index is retrieved, wherein the data deviation index is obtained by the following formula:

[0077]

[0078] Where R represents the data deviation index; σ c σ represents the standard deviation of the collected data volume of m sliding windows, based on the total amount of data collected for each sliding window; n represents the number of data collections for each sliding window; σ i This represents the standard deviation of the data volume corresponding to n data acquisitions within the i-th sliding window; specifically, The global standard deviation σ c By averaging over the number of windows m, we obtain the "theoretical fluctuation benchmark that each window should have" (ideally, global and local fluctuations should be consistent). Local standard deviation σ i The average fluctuation of each window is obtained by averaging the number of data collections n; R represents the absolute difference between the theoretical fluctuation benchmark and the actual average fluctuation, which is used to reflect the degree of deviation of the global-local data collection stability.

[0079] Retrieve the resource consumption (such as memory utilization, bandwidth utilization and / or CPU utilization) of each sliding window in the current data source for data collection.

[0080] The standard deviation of resource energy consumption is obtained by using the resource energy consumption of each sliding window corresponding to the current data acquisition from the data source.

[0081] The standard deviation of resource energy consumption corresponding to the data source is normalized to obtain the normalized standard deviation of resource energy consumption.

[0082] The resource energy consumption deviation is obtained by combining the normalized standard deviation of the resource energy consumption corresponding to the data source with the standard deviation of the collected data of m completed sliding windows, with the total amount of collected data corresponding to each sliding window as the benchmark.

[0083] The resource energy consumption deviation is obtained by the following formula:

[0084] Y = log 10 (1+|σ e -σ gc |)

[0085] Where Y represents the deviation of resource energy consumption; σ e σ represents the standard deviation of resource energy consumption corresponding to the data source after normalization. gc This represents the standard deviation of the data collected by the m sliding windows corresponding to the normalized data source; specifically, |σ e -σ gc | Used to reflect the "coordination between data collection behavior and resource consumption" (ideally, resource consumption should also fluctuate synchronously when data volume fluctuates greatly); log 10 (1+|σ e -σ gc |) Using logarithmic functions to "compress extreme values ​​and amplify small differences" can both prevent outliers from dominating the results and sensitively capture "small collaborative anomalies" (such as no change in data volume, but a sudden increase in resource consumption, which may indicate redundant data collection).

[0086] A redundancy quantification function is obtained by utilizing the data deviation index and resource energy consumption deviation of the data source;

[0087] The redundancy metric function is obtained through the following formula:

[0088]

[0089] Where J represents the redundancy quantification function; λ represents the preset time sensitivity factor, with a value range of (0, 1); I t (τ) represents the time-shifted mutual information entropy of the data source; specifically, By taking the geometric mean of "data deviation" and "resource coordination anomaly", the anomalies in the two dimensions "reinforce each other" (the redundancy judgment is more significant when data anomalies and resource anomalies exist at the same time). The exponential function is used to introduce a negative adjustment for "time series dependence"; J comprehensively reflects the interrelationship between "severity of data anomalies" (R), "co-abnormality of resource consumption and data" (Y) and "reasonableness of time series" (It(τ)), and finally outputs a dynamic quantitative value to determine "whether the degree of redundancy is abnormal".

[0090] The value corresponding to the redundancy quantification function is compared with a preset function threshold, wherein the function threshold is determined based on experience;

[0091] When the value corresponding to the redundancy quantification function exceeds the preset function threshold, the redundancy level of the real-time data is determined to be abnormal.

[0092] The technical effects of the above solution are as follows: The above solution constructs a multi-dimensional correlation model of "data deviation - resource energy consumption - time-shift mutual information entropy". First, using a sliding window as the unit, the data deviation index (R) is calculated through the standard deviation of data volume and the number of collections to characterize the abnormal fluctuations in data collection volume. Then, the resource energy consumption dimension is introduced, and through standard deviation calculation, normalization, and deviation analysis (Y) from the standard deviation of data volume, the synergistic anomalies between data collection behavior and resource consumption are correlated. Finally, the time-sensitive factor (λ) and time-shift mutual information entropy I are fused. t (τ) Construct a redundancy quantification function (J) to integrate data fluctuations, resource consumption, and time series dependencies into a unified model, thereby achieving accurate quantitative judgment and anomaly alarm for the degree of redundancy. Compared to existing redundancy determination methods, which often rely solely on simple dimensions such as data volume repetition and timestamp intervals, resulting in insufficient dimensional coverage and weak scenario adaptability, the aforementioned technical solution breaks through the limitations of a single dimension. It employs a multi-indicator hierarchical fusion approach—using data deviation indicators to capture statistical anomalies in collected data, using resource energy consumption deviation to correlate data collection with system resource coordination anomalies, and introducing time-shifted mutual information entropy to incorporate the dependency characteristics of time series. Furthermore, it uses time-sensitive factors to adapt to the time sensitivity requirements of different scenarios. The constructed redundancy quantification function (J) more comprehensively and dynamically reflects the essential characteristics of data collection redundancy, improving the accuracy of redundancy determination and scenario adaptability. In addition, the entire process, from data fluctuation monitoring to resource correlation analysis and multi-factor fusion modeling, forms a complete logical closed loop from anomaly identification to redundancy quantification. This allows for more precise location of the root cause when redundancy anomalies occur, providing richer decision-making basis for subsequent data collection optimization and resource scheduling adjustments. This effectively compensates for the shortcomings of existing technologies in low redundancy determination accuracy and insufficient correlation analysis in complex scenarios.

[0112] An adaptive resource allocation algorithm based on load prediction is adopted. By monitoring indicators such as CPU utilization, memory usage and data throughput in the simulation scenario, the allocation strategy of computing resources such as physical servers and Docker containers is dynamically adjusted, and hardware acceleration resources are given priority in high-load scenarios such as equipment failure simulation.

[0113] A consistency verification mechanism for cross-platform simulation environments is constructed. For different system compilation environments such as Elektronix, Android, and CentOS, a virtual machine image packaging tool is used to achieve integrated encapsulation of the compilation toolchain, dependency libraries, and component runtime, ensuring instruction-level compatibility of simulation applications on different platforms.

[0114] Design an interface adaptation layer for the hardware simulation test environment and real-time data components. Based on the hardware development checklist (schematic / PCB design specifications) of the unified R&D platform, realize the mapping and verification of communication protocols and electrical parameters between the simulation model and IoT terminals such as power distribution smart gateways and video acquisition equipment.
